深入理解Oracle的三大选择(oracle三个选项)

深入理解Oracle的三大选择

Oracle是一款功能强大的关系型数据库管理系统,拥有广泛的应用领域和广泛的用户群体。对于初学者来说,选择一个适合自己的Oracle版本是非常重要的,这需要对Oracle的不同版本有一个深入的理解。本文将介绍三个Oracle版本,即Oracle Database Standard Edition、Oracle Database Enterprise Edition和Oracle Database Express Edition,帮助读者了解这三个版本之间的差异和优缺点。

Oracle Database Standard Edition

Oracle Database Standard Edition是一个面向小型企业和中等规模应用的版本。它包括了大部分的Oracle基本功能,比如存储、备份、恢复、以及安全性。与Enterprise Edition相比,Standard Edition有一些功能限制,比如不能使用RAC、Data Guard和Partitioning等多节点和高可用性功能。此外,与Enterprise Edition相比,Standard Edition的许可证价格更低,但是不适用于大型企业。

Oracle Database Enterprise Edition

Oracle Database Enterprise Edition是一个适用于任何规模企业的版本,它包括了所有Oracle的核心功能和高级功能,比如RAC、Data Guard、Partitioning、Advanced Security、Real Application Testing、以及Multitenant等。这些功能不仅能够提高数据的可用性,还能加强安全性和性能。然而,与Standard Edition相比,Enterprise Edition的价格更高,而且也需要更多的硬件资源。

Oracle Database Express Edition

Oracle Database Express Edition是一个免费的版本,可以在Windows和Linux操作系统上运行。它是面向开发人员和小型企业的,适用于测试和开发环境。虽然它有一些限制,比如最大数据库容量为11GB,最多只能使用1GB的内存,但是它包含了Oracle数据库的所有核心功能。此外,它还支持多种编程语言和开发工具,包括Java、C、C++、.NET、Python等等。

结论

在选择Oracle数据库版本时,需要考虑许多因素,包括成本、功能、内存和硬件需求等等。对于小型企业和中等规模应用,Oracle Database Standard Edition可能是一个不错的选择。而对于大型企业,Oracle Database Enterprise Edition则更适合。至于Oracle Database Express Edition,它的免费和功能齐全的特点适合开发人员和小型企业。通过了解这些版本的优缺点,用户可以在购买之前明确自己的需求,选择最适合自己的版本。下面是在Oracle Database Express Edition中创建一个表并插入数据的代码示例:

CREATE TABLE sample_table (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T
);
INSERT INTO sample_table VALUES (1, 'Alice', 25);
INSERT INTO sample_table VALUES (2, 'Bob', 30);
INSERT INTO sample_table VALUES (3, 'Charlie', 35);

数据运维技术 » 深入理解Oracle的三大选择(oracle三个选项)